Documentation and UK Compliance
Reputable providers insist on a formal credit application for net-30 billing terms because it establishes a professional layer of financial trust. This process includes verifying your firm’s PCO (Public Carriage Office) licensing standards and insurance coverage to mitigate corporate liability. Adhering to these best practices for commercial ground transportation ensures that your organization is protected. We also recommend setting up cost-centre codes during this stage. This simple step allows your finance department to cross-charge departments internally with total accuracy, eliminating hours of manual reconciliation. Reporting and Analytics for Travel Managers
Generating monthly spend reports allows your finance department to track department-level travel budgets with absolute precision. These analytics help identify recurring travel patterns, enabling you to optimize vehicle selection and booking lead times for maximum efficiency. Crucially, every invoice generated through our system is fully VAT-compliant, facilitating the straightforward reclamation of the standard 20% UK VAT rate on chauffeur services. This transparency transforms ground transport from a variable, often hidden expense into a manageable and audited corporate asset.
